Large Volume Shipments to Jamaica

Important Notice for Customers with Large Volume Shipments Dear Valued Customers, As we approach the Peak Season, we want to ensure a smooth and efficient process for all our Caribbean Cargo DC (CCDC) customers. If you have a large volume of items to ship, please consider whether you will be clearing your shipments under the Returning Resident Scheme. If so, it is essential to begin the application process before shipping your cargo. Starting the documentation process early will enable faster clearance upon arrival in Jamaica. You can find more information and begin your application on the Jamaica Customs website :http://www.jacustoms.gov.jm. Given the annual congestion during this time, our goal is to expedite the clearance of aged cargo to make room for current and upcoming shipments. Applying for the concession after your shipment has arrived can cause further delays. Therefore, CCDC will be screening shipments for customers shipping containers and large volumes to Jamaica to streamline the process for faster clearance. This update comes per an urgent notice from our at-destination shipping partner, Combined Freight Forwarders, for Montego Bay, Freeport, and St. James, Jamaica. Together, we can make this process work for mutual benefit.
